#e4d5e0 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#e4d5e0 is composed of 89.4% red, 83.5%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.6% magenta, 1.8%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 316 degrees, a saturation of 21.7% and a lightness of 86.5%. #e4d5e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c9abc1.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#e4d5e0 color description : Light grayish pink.
The hexadecimal color #e4d5e0 has RGB values of R:228, G:213,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.07, Y:0.02,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14996960.
